Course content
Safety in PE with a focus on badminton. Rules of badminton. Badminton racquets and materials - selection of suitable racquets and strings. Basic holding racquet, the game. Practicing service, the game. Practicing service reception, the game. Practicing overhead stroke, the game. Practicing smash, the game. Practicing defensive game, smash choice, the game. Singles tactics for beginners, the game. Individual tournament. Doubles tactics, the game. Doubles tournament.

Learning outcomes
To allow students to do regular physical activity available and use it to keep in good physical and mental condition. During the semester, students learn the rules, basic strokes and basic gaming activities of individuals and couples.
Students master key game activities - service, long and short drive, smash and smash choice. In theory, they learn basic rules of the game and are familiar with the basics of sports training in badminton.
